Output 668f741b803721633cbd1d65e6280bf1840d18d9f68612ce258991d8c5010d7b:22

value
1348137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7dc3f6ad60cb289b1f90fb738c5b1d0be0e47d OP_EQUAL
address
38fTwTjkS9kyEmCKNk9u8Ezo6dZBfENoQo
transaction
668f741b803721633cbd1d65e6280bf1840d18d9f68612ce258991d8c5010d7b
spent
true